Choosing Budget-Friendly General Education Programs
When I helped a friend decide between a pricey private university and a state school with a strong G.E. curriculum, we evaluated three criteria: cost, interdisciplinary depth, and transferability of credits.
- Cost Transparency: Schools that publish a full fee schedule online make it easier to calculate total expenses. Hidden lab fees or mandatory textbook purchases can quickly inflate the price.
- Interdisciplinary Breadth: Look for programs that require courses across the humanities, social sciences, natural sciences, and quantitative reasoning. The “General Education Lenses” model used by many universities ensures you touch every major knowledge area.
- Credit Transferability: If you plan to switch majors or schools, choose G.E. courses that are widely accepted. Community colleges often align their curricula with the “General Educational Development” standards, making transfer smoother.

Q: Where can I find affordable general education textbooks?
A: Many colleges partner with open-access publishers, and platforms like OpenStax provide free digital versions. Community colleges also offer low-cost editions, and some universities provide textbook scholarships for G.E. students.
